Odisha NEET PG 2025 Counselling Registration Process: The Odisha NEET PG 2025 counselling is held for admission into postgraduate medical courses in the state. The Directorate of Medical Education and Training (DMET), Odisha, organizes the counselling process. Candidates who qualify in NEET PG 2025 and satisfy the eligibility requirements can attend the counselling. The Odisha NEET PG 2025 Counselling Registration Process involves several steps like submission of application form, document verification, choice filling, and seat allotment. Odisha NEET PG 2025 Counselling Eligibility Criteria

To join the Odisha NEET PG counselling process, candidates need to meet particular eligibility criteria. The candidates should be a permanent resident of Odisha. In case they are not residents, they should have MBBS from a government medical college of Odisha. They should possess a valid MBBS or BDS degree from a recognized university. State or Central Medical Council registration is compulsory and necessary. The candidates should obtain the minimum NEET PG 2025 cutoff marks. Also, completion of a one-year internship prior to the given date is required.

Criteria Requirements
Domicile Permanent resident of Odisha or MBBS from a Govt. Medical College in Odisha
Qualification MBBS/BDS from a recognized medical college
Registration Registered with State/Central Medical Council
Minimum Marks Must secure the NEET PG cutoff marks
Internship One-year internship completion before the given date

Odisha NEET PG 2025 Counselling Registration Process 

The registration process for Odisha NEET PG 2025 counselling includes multiple stages. Below is the detailed breakdown of each stage:

Step 1: Online Registration

  • Visit the official website of DMET Odisha: dmetodisha.gov.in
  • Click on the ‘Odisha NEET PG 2025 Counselling’ link.
  • Select the ‘New Registration’ option.
  • Enter details such as name, NEET PG 2025 roll number, email ID, and mobile number.
  • Create a password and submit the details.
  • After successful registration, login credentials will be sent to the registered email and mobile number.

Step 2: Filling the Application Form

  • Login using the registered credentials.
  • Enter personal details such as name, date of birth, gender, and category.
  • Provide academic details including MBBS/BDS qualification, year of passing, and university name.
  • Enter NEET PG 2025 details, including score and rank.
  • Upload scanned copies of required documents.

Step 3: Payment of Application Fee

  • Candidates must pay a non-refundable application fee of INR 2500.
  • Payment can be made through net banking, credit card, debit card, or UPI.
  • After successful payment, download and print the fee receipt for future reference.

Step 4: Document Verification

  • Attend the document verification process in virtual or physical mode.
  • Carry original and photocopies of required documents.
  • Officials will verify the authenticity of documents.
  • After successful verification, the online application will be authenticated.

Step 5: Merit List Publication

  • The merit list will be released after document verification.
  • It includes candidate name, category, NEET PG score, and All India Rank.
  • Only candidates listed in the merit list will be eligible for choice filling and seat allotment.

Step 6: Choice Filling & Locking

  • Login to the official portal and access the choice filling section.
  • Select preferred colleges and courses in order of preference.
  • Lock the choices before the deadline.
  • Candidates who fail to lock choices will not be considered for seat allotment.

Step 7: Seat Allotment Process

  • Seat allotment is based on NEET PG rank, filled choices, and reservation criteria.
  • The results will be published on the official website.
  • Candidates allotted a seat must download the allotment letter.

Step 8: Reporting to the Allotted College

  • Candidates must report to the allotted college within the given time frame.
  • Submit original documents for verification at the college.
  • Pay the admission fee to confirm the seat.

Documents Required for Odisha NEET PG 2025 Counselling

Candidates must carry the following documents for verification:

  • NEET PG 2025 Scorecard
  • NEET PG 2025 Admit Card
  • MBBS/BDS Degree Certificate
  • Internship Completion Certificate
  • State/Central Medical Registration Certificate
  • Category Certificate (if applicable)
  • Domicile Certificate (for Odisha candidates)
  • Valid ID Proof (Aadhar Card, Passport, Voter ID)
  • Payment Receipt of Counselling Fee

Odisha NEET PG 2025 Counselling Process FAQs

What is the official website for Odisha NEET PG 2025 counselling registration?

The official website for registration is dmetodisha.gov.in.

Who is eligible for the Odisha NEET PG 2025 counselling?

Candidates should have an MBBS or BDS degree, have completed one year of internship, and should have passed NEET PG 2025.

What is the fee of applying for Odisha NEET PG 2025 counselling?

The registration fee for Odisha NEET PG 2025 counselling is INR 2500, which is required to be paid online.

How is seat allotment conducted in Odisha NEET PG 2025 counselling?

Seat allotment is done through the NEET PG rank, the choices specified by candidates, and the respective reservation rules.

Is it necessary to undergo document verification for Odisha NEET PG 2025 counselling?

Yes, candidates are required to participate in document verification to be eligible for the merit list.

How many rounds of counselling are held for Odisha NEET PG 2025?

There are four rounds: two conducted online, one mop-up round, and a stray vacancy round.

What happens if I do not report to the allotted college through Odisha NEET PG 2025 counselling?

If a candidate does not report within the given time, the seat allotted will be lost.

Can I participate in counselling if I don't possess an Odisha domicile?

Non-domicile candidates are eligible to apply if they have passed MBBS from an Odisha government medical college.
